在数字化时代,Web前端开发已经成为IT行业的热门职业之一。掌握Web前端技术,不仅可以轻松驾驭网页设计,还能为个人职业发展打开新的大门。本文将从入门到精通,为您提供一份全面的全攻略。
第一部分:Web前端基础入门
1.1 初识Web前端
Web前端是指运行在用户浏览器端的程序,负责用户界面展示和交互。主要包括HTML、CSS和JavaScript三大技术。
1.2 HTML入门
HTML(HyperText Markup Language)是网页内容的骨架。学习HTML,您需要掌握以下内容:
- 网页结构
- 标签与属性
- 文档类型声明(Doctype)
- 网页布局
1.3 CSS入门
CSS(Cascading Style Sheets)是网页的美容师,负责网页样式设计。学习CSS,您需要掌握以下内容:
- 选择器
- 属性
- 布局
- 响应式设计
1.4 JavaScript入门
JavaScript是一种脚本语言,用于实现网页的交互功能。学习JavaScript,您需要掌握以下内容:
- 变量与数据类型
- 控制结构
- 函数
- 事件处理
第二部分:进阶学习
2.1 HTML5与CSS3新特性
HTML5和CSS3是Web前端技术的重要发展,为网页设计提供了更多可能性。学习HTML5与CSS3,您可以:
- 使用新标签和属性
- 利用CSS3实现更丰富的动画效果
- 掌握响应式设计技巧
2.2 JavaScript高级特性
JavaScript的高级特性包括闭包、原型链、异步编程等。掌握这些特性,可以让您的JavaScript代码更加优雅和高效。
2.3 框架与库
目前,有许多流行的Web前端框架和库,如React、Vue、Angular等。学习这些框架和库,可以加快您的开发速度,提高代码质量。
第三部分:实战演练
3.1 项目实战
通过实际项目,您可以巩固所学知识,提高自己的编程能力。以下是一些适合初学者的项目:
- 制作个人博客
- 开发在线简历
- 制作简单的电商网站
3.2 工具与插件
学习一些常用的Web前端工具和插件,可以大大提高您的开发效率。以下是一些常用的工具和插件:
- Sublime Text、Visual Studio Code等编辑器
- Chrome DevTools调试工具
- Bootstrap、Foundation等前端框架
- jQuery、Vue.js等库
第四部分:持续学习与进阶
4.1 跟进新技术
Web前端技术更新迅速,持续学习新技术是提高自己竞争力的关键。您可以关注以下渠道:
- 关注国内外知名技术博客
- 参加技术交流大会
- 加入技术社群
4.2 深入研究
在掌握Web前端基础知识后,您可以深入研究以下领域:
- 前端工程化
- 性能优化
- 响应式设计
- 网络安全
通过以上四个部分的学习,相信您已经具备了从入门到精通的能力。祝您在Web前端领域取得优异成绩!
